But you need to stop cleaning your pc, when you cleanup your pc you remove the dumps which are very important in troubleshooting.
If you are using a program like Ccleaner please stop using it while troubleshooting.
This because programs like Ccleaner remove dump files that are needed to troubleshoot.
Or configure Ccleaner to not remove dump files:

If your system crashes in safe mode it means a hardware problem
If the system doesn't crash, it means a software problem or driver that isn't loaded in safe mode.

Please disconnect your USB network adapter while troubleshooting.
USB network adapters may cause trouble when troubleshooting as they often interfere with the network drivers or are having problems with the usb ports.

In the unloaded modules Antimalwarebytes was 2 times mentioned
Unloaded modules:
fffff800`efda4000 fffff800`efdd7000 MBAMSwissArm
fffff800`efcbb000 fffff800`efcce000 mwac.sys
And in the eventviewer at the same time Date: 2016-01-22T06:35:41.326 was named 'MBAMProtector' with the Bluescreen time Date: 2016-01-22T06:35:42.000
The computer has rebooted from a bugcheck. The bugcheck was: 0x0000009f (0x0000000000000003, 0xffffe00177286060, 0xfffff803b06c1aa0, 0xffffe0017b930c60). A dump was saved in: C:\Windows\MEMORY.DMP. Report Id: 012216-12984-01.

Please uninstall Malwarebytes.
To uninstall Malwarebytes Anti-Malware from your computer, please use our Malwarebytes Clean Uninstall Tool, mbam-clean.exe. This tool was created to completely remove all traces of the program from your computer.
To use the utility:

  1. Download and run mbam-clean.exe
  2. Restart your computer when prompted.
Note: This tool will completely remove any settings you have configured, your license information, and anything else related to Malwarebytes Anti-Malware. If you need to save any of these, please do not run this tool.
